/// Generic Keccak-p sponge function.
///
/// # Panics
/// If the `ROUNDS` is greater than `L::KECCAK_F_ROUND_COUNT`.
#[allow(non_upper_case_globals, unused_assignments)]
pub(crate) fn keccak_p<L: LaneSize, const ROUNDS: usize>(state: &mut [L; PLEN]) {
    // https://nvlpubs.nist.gov/nistpubs/FIPS/NIST.FIPS.202.pdf#page=25
    // "the rounds of KECCAK-p[b, nr] match the last rounds of KECCAK-f[b]"
    let round_consts = RC[..L::KECCAK_F_ROUND_COUNT]
        .last_chunk::<ROUNDS>()
        .expect("Number of rounds greater than `KECCAK_F_ROUND_COUNT` is not supported!")
        .map(L::truncate_rc);

    // Not unrolling this loop results in a much smaller function, plus
    // it positively influences performance due to the smaller load on I-cache
    for rc in round_consts {
        let mut array = [L::default(); 5];

        // Theta
        unroll5!(x, {
            unroll5!(y, {
                array[x] ^= state[5 * y + x];
            });
        });

        unroll5!(x, {
            let t1 = array[(x + 4) % 5];
            let t2 = array[(x + 1) % 5].rotate_left(1);
            unroll5!(y, {
                state[5 * y + x] ^= t1 ^ t2;
            });
        });

        // Rho and pi
        let mut last = state[1];
        unroll24!(x, {
            array[0] = state[PI[x]];
            state[PI[x]] = last.rotate_left(RHO[x]);
            last = array[0];
        });

        // Chi
        unroll5!(y_step, {
            let y = 5 * y_step;

            array.copy_from_slice(&state[y..][..5]);

            unroll5!(x, {
                let t1 = !array[(x + 1) % 5];
                let t2 = array[(x + 2) % 5];
                state[y + x] = array[x] ^ (t1 & t2);
            });
        });

        // Iota
        state[0] ^= rc;
    }
}
